9744 reviewsWe stayed here in early August for 10 days with my wife and two children ( 15 & 12 ) in a half board, sea view room with the unique package. Our room was large and had a main bedroom with a lounge/2nd bedroom that had a sofa bed. We requested a 'roll away' bed so the kids didn't have to share. The room was otherwise spotless and large enough for our needs. The hotel itself is large but extremely well maintained and overall very impressive. There is one very large main infinity pool where activities occur such as water aerobics etc. The second pool is a very large lazy river style with a swim up bar. There is a regular swimming pool and a 4th pool just for the use of 'unique' guests. There are loads of sunbeds and it was very refreshing to be able to come to the pool at 8.30/9am and still see loads of beds available. It's not necessary to come down at 6am just to nab the best beds. Staff are fantastic and coming round the beds to offer drinks etc. There are a number of bars available serving food for lunch ( hamburgers/ spare ribs / sandwiches etc ). You can also go out the back of the hotel and get a takeaway pizza to bring it back. The buffet is enormous and feels like it's 100 metres long with individual stations serving everything imaginable. It can get pretty busy but the queues move pretty quickly. As best as I can tell the standard of food seemed very high and different choices each night. There is a separate italian restaurant which we went to but weren't massive fans of it - there was nothing wrong with it, it just didn't do much for us. Otherwise there are a few other restaurants that are attached to the hotel but not part of the hotel - a Japanese place and a steak place. Otherwise there is entertainment each evening, a magic show, acrobatics, a tribute band etc. All good fun. In terms of location, out the back and front of the hotel there are loads of shops and restaurants. We hired a car from the hotel and visited a few local towns for some days out. You do have to pay for hotel parking (16 Euro's a day ). I would definitely return here - the grounds are beautiful, staff are great and we had a very relaxing time. Top tip - if you take the unique package, contact the hotel in advance and they will arrange a taxi to pick you up from the airport and take you back. I didn't realize this and found out by accident.

Plans for the journey: have a rest and enjoy! Lopesan Costa Meloneras Resort & Spa Hotel is located in Maspalomas. This resort is located 2 km from the city center. You can take a walk and explore the neighbourhood area of the resort . Places nearby: Maspalomas Beach, Amadores Beach and Canarian Museum.
